The 1996 direct-to-video action film , starring late pop-culture icon Anna Nicole Smith , has long held a legendary status among connoisseurs of late-night cable and premium B-movie cinema. Produced during the absolute peak of the 1990s direct-to-video boom, the film is famously recognized as a low-budget, highly sexualized clone of Die Hard . The story follows Carrie Wisk (played by Anna Nicole Smith), a helicopter pilot who arrives at the tallest skyscraper in Los Angeles to deliver a passenger. However, she unwittingly walks into a hostage situation. A group of ruthless terrorists, led by the villainous Fairfax (played by Richard Gabai), has seized the building to steal a state-of-the-art weapon activation system.
